Headless E-commerce vs Composable Commerce
Headless and composable architectures, while distinct concepts in the realm of digital technology, are closely related and often work in tandem, particularly in the context of e-commerce and content management systems.
As mentioned, in a headless architecture, the front end (or the "head") – which is the user interface and experience part – is decoupled from the back end, where all the data management, business logic, and integrative functionalities reside.
This decoupling allows for greater flexibility in how content or services are delivered to various front-end platforms, like websites, mobile apps, or even IoT devices.
Composable architecture refers to a modular approach where individual components or services of a system can be independently developed, deployed, and managed. Each component, often a microservice, performs a specific function and communicates with other components via APIs.
This modular approach allows businesses to tailor, upgrade, or replace each component without affecting the entire system.
Note: Our aim is to keep this article focused on headless e-commerce, but we have written a detailed article about composable architecture and composable commerce here.
The Intersection: How Headless Relates to Composable
There are, of course, commonalities between headless and composable systems. The key is to implement the best system needed for your business to grow (ask us for our unbiased opinion - that’s kind of our thing).
Take a look at where the headless e-commerce and composable intersect:
Flexibility and Customization
Both headless and composable architectures offer flexibility. In headless systems, this flexibility is seen in the front-end presentation layer, where businesses can create custom user experiences across different platforms. In composable systems, flexibility is inherent in the ability to mix, match, and replace various back-end components as needed.
Agility in Response to Market Demands
Headless architectures allow businesses to quickly adapt their user interface to changing market trends without overhauling the back-end systems. Similarly, composable architectures enable rapid adaptation of back-end functionalities, scaling, or integrating new services without disrupting existing operations.
Tech Stack Diversification
Both approaches allow businesses to choose best-of-breed solutions for different functions. In a headless setup, the front-end developers are not limited by the back-end technology choices. In a composable setup, each back-end service can be selected based on its specific merit, irrespective of others.
Enhanced User Experience and Back End Efficiency
While headless architecture is primarily focused on creating a seamless and dynamic user experience, composable architecture ensures back-end processes are optimized, efficient, and easy to maintain. Together, they enable businesses to create powerful, efficient, and highly adaptable digital platforms.
API-Driven Interactions
Both architectures heavily rely on APIs for communication. In headless systems, APIs connect the back end to various front ends. In composable systems, APIs facilitate interaction between different microservices or components.
To summarize:
Headless e-commerce is about decoupling the front end and back-end to improve the user experience and front-end development flexibility.
Composable commerce focuses on the back end, breaking it down into smaller, manageable, and interchangeable components.
Benefits of Combining Headless E-commerce and Composable Commerce
When headless e-commerce and composable commerce are combined, they offer a powerful approach to building scalable, adaptable, and efficient digital platforms that can evolve with changing business needs and technological advancements.
💪🏼 Enhanced Flexibility and Agility: When combined, headless e-commerce and composable commerce provide a high level of flexibility. Headless architecture allows for diverse and customized front-end experiences, while composable commerce enables the back end to be assembled from various independent services or components.
This combination allows enterprises to rapidly adapt both their customer-facing interfaces and their back-end processes to changing market demands.
📶 Scalability and Performance: Together, they offer superior scalability. The headless approach optimizes front-end performance across various platforms, while composable commerce ensures that the back end can efficiently handle varying workloads and functionalities as the business grows.
⭐ Best-of-Breed Approach: This combination allows enterprises to choose the best possible solution for each aspect of their e-commerce system. They can select the most suitable platforms and technologies for different components like shopping carts, payment processing, inventory management, etc., and integrate them seamlessly into a cohesive system.
How do you decide whether to use Headless, Composable, or both?
In practice, the synergy of headless e-commerce and composable commerce is often more beneficial for enterprises, especially those looking to stay competitive in a fast-paced digital market.
This combination provides a comprehensive solution that addresses both the need for an engaging customer experience and the demand for a flexible, scalable back-end.
However, the choice to use them together or separately should be aligned with the enterprise's specific business goals, digital maturity, and long-term IT strategy.
At Alpha Solutions, we categorize companies into three distinct groups regarding the approach to composable commerce:
1. Composable All the Way
These companies are fully committed to composable commerce. They either have the in-house capability to manage the complexities of composable headless systems or partner with technology experts like us to handle their tech and DevOps needs.
2. Targeted Composable
Businesses in this category have a stable system and integrate new, composable components selectively. This approach aligns with true composability—starting with single components and expanding gradually, ensuring faster ROI and directional accuracy.
3. Play It Safe Composable
For companies focusing more on business operations than technology, the key is reliability and trustworthiness. They might opt for a comprehensive system that meets all their needs or rely on a partner like Alpha Solutions to manage a pre-composed headless commerce system.
Which one are you?
We’d be happy to chat with you about whether or not a headless e-commerce solution is the right option for your business.
Our team has successfully helped many diverse businesses implement headless e-commerce platforms after determining it was the best strategic decision for long-term growth and scalability.
Whether you choose composable, headless, or both, selecting the right platform is crucial.
When it comes to choosing the best e-commerce platform for your needs, factors to consider include:
At Alpha Solutions, we assess platforms based on their flexibility, feature set, and ease of integration with other business systems, ensuring they align with our clients' long-term strategic goals.